PixelExperience for POCO X3 NFC/POCO X3 [surya/karna]
What is this?
Pixel Experience is an AOSP based ROM, with Google apps included and all Pixel goodies (launcher, wallpapers, icons, fonts, bootanimation)
Our mission is to offer the maximum possible stability and security, along with essential and useful features for the proper functioning of the device
Based on Android 10.0

Hello, actually on latest miui rom, followed the steps as told on the given link, on first post, but it's buggy as hell on the setup steps at first launch, dunno if it's only me, but here what I did:
- installed latest orange fox recovery (alpha 6)
- booted on it
- flashed latest miui eu through recovery (12.0.3.0.QJGEUXM)
- reboot to recovery again
- flashed pixel experience rom
- factory format (The format data step is not so clear, I tried only the data partition as well, with or without flashing dalvik)
- reboot to system
When I'm at the system step, the "search for updates" usually makes the phone reboot, it's taking a loooooong time to pass this setup steps.
I finally managed to pass the setup steps, but it took me more than a hour to pass this.
I'm pretty sure it's a pebkac, not the rom at fault or else, so if you have any idea on what was my mistake, I'm taking any advice here
PS: Also tried with twrp, tried to flash mieu eu rom from recovery, and from fastboot, etc...
EDIT: Also, thanks for reading my question and for the work here, I love pixel experience rom, would love to have it on this phone

How to flash?
From any ROM, including OOS:
- Grab the latest latest Rom by going to the official Website (https://download.pixelexperience.org/guacamoleb).
- Grab the latest OOS release, OB13 as of writing (OB14 firmware has a bugged fingerprint)
- Grab TWRP (prefer the unofficial variant) from here
- Grab adb platform tools from here
- Extract it, add the folder to PATH, if you donno how to add something to PATH,
Windows: check this
Mac & Linux: export PATH="whatever-is-the-path-to-your-adb-folder:$PATH"
- Ensure you have backed up your data and/or you are already unlocked.
- Ensure OEM Unlocking is turned on.
- Boot your phone into fastboot. It would a show "START" with some details about your phone.
- Connect your phone to the PC with the USB-C cable, and see if its recognised when you type
Code:
fastboot devices
- If it does, just type
Code:
fastboot oem unlock
- You would get a prompt on your phone, that if you are sure to unlock the bootloader. If sure, navigate with the volume buttons and hit a yes.
- If your unlock succeeds, your phone will wipe itself, and boot back into OOS.
- Reboot it again to fastboot and connect your phone to the PC.
- Now open up the command prompt, and check if
Code:
fastboot devices
shows up a connected device.
- Issue these commands on your command prompt
Code:
fastboot boot path-to-your-img-file
- Once this is done, TWRP should welcome you with warm greetings.
- Just, go ahead to the wipe section of twrp and press format data and type yes.
- Once you are done with the format data, just go ahead and connect your phone to PC.
- If you need f2fs for data partition, go again to the wipe section and manage/repair partitions, select data, and change it to f2fs.
- You might need to reboot, and go back to fastboot, and boot into twrp.
- Now transfer the ROM zip and OOS zip to the internal storage
- Go to twrp, locate your OOS zip, flash it.
- Similarly, locate your ROM zip, and swipe to flash it.
- Once you are done, reboot and you should be on PE.

crDroid is designed to increase performance and reliability over stock Android for your device also attempting to bringing many of the best features existent today
Features:
https://github.com/crdroidandroid/crdroid_features/blob/12.1/README.mkdn
Flashing Instructions:
Pre-installation:
TWRP (Download from here)
gapps : Nikgapps basic tested
Magisk 24.3 for root - (Download from here)
First time installation:
Reboot to bootloader
Fastboot boot twrp.img
Adb sideload crdroid zip
Reboot to recovery
Adb sideload a Google Apps package of your choice
Factory reset
Reboot
